September 27, 2019
Oakland, Calif. – Sept. 27, 2019: Operating income at the Port of Oakland increased 4.1 percent in Fiscal Year 2019, according to figures released today. The Port reported operating income of $66 million for the year on operating revenue of $397 million. The Port said its operating income was at an all-time high. FY 2019… Read More
